NASA Crew-11 astronauts returning early from ISS after medical problem


NEWNow you can hearken to Fox Information articles!

NASA introduced plans Thursday to deliver Crew-11 house from the Worldwide Area Station (ISS) forward of schedule after a crew member skilled a medical problem, stressing the astronaut is secure, and the transfer is precautionary — not an emergency evacuation.

The early return marks an uncommon however managed transfer by NASA, timed to reduce disruption to house station operations.

NASA Administrator Jared Isaacman mentioned the choice adopted consultations with company management and medical officers.

“In these endeavors, together with the 25 years of steady human presence on board the Worldwide Area Station, the well being and the well-being of our astronauts is at all times and might be our highest precedence,” he mentioned. “Yesterday, Jan. 7, a single crew member on board the station skilled a medical state of affairs and is now secure.

“After discussions with Chief Well being and Medical Officer Dr. James Polk and management throughout the company, I’ve come to the choice that it is in the most effective curiosity of our astronauts to return Crew-11 forward of their deliberate departure inside the coming days,” Isaacman continued. “The Dragon Endeavour spacecraft will depart the Worldwide Area Station with Commander Zena Cardman, pilot Mike Fincke, Kimia Yui from JAXA and Oleg Platonov of Roscosmos, and safely return them to Earth.”

Isaacman mentioned the company expects to offer an replace inside the subsequent 48 hours on the anticipated undocking and reentry timeline.

Over the previous 5 months, Crew-11 accomplished most of its mission goals, supporting house station operations and conducting scientific analysis.

NASA mentioned Crew-12 is scheduled to launch as quickly as mid-February, with the company evaluating whether or not an earlier launch is feasible, whereas NASA astronaut Chris Williams will stay aboard the station to take care of an American presence and assist ongoing operations.

Affiliate Administrator Amit Kshatriya mentioned flight controllers and astronauts adopted established procedures, calling the response a textbook instance of NASA’s coaching for surprising occasions.

“Each dialogue during the last 24 hours as we’ve assessed the state of affairs…crew security has at all times remained our highest precedence,” Kshatriya mentioned. “We by no means take shortcuts. We by no means compromise relating to defending our astronauts.”

NASA’s chief medical officer mentioned the choice was pushed by limits on conducting a full diagnostic workup aboard the house station.

Dr. James Polk mentioned the astronaut is secure however that diagnostic uncertainty in microgravity prompted NASA to err on the facet of bringing the crew member again to Earth.

“As a result of the astronaut is totally secure, it’s not an emergent evacuation – We’re not, instantly disembarking and getting the astronaut down,” Polk mentioned. “Nevertheless it leaves that lingering threat and lingering query as to what that analysis is…and so at all times, we err on the facet of the astronaut’s well being and welfare.”

The announcement comes as Crew-11 members had been scheduled to conduct a 6.5-hour spacewalk Thursday to put in {hardware} outdoors the ISS.

Astronauts usually stay aboard the ISS for stints of six to eight months and are outfitted with primary medical tools and drugs within the occasion of an emergency.

The crew launched from Florida in August and had been scheduled to return to Earth in Could.

Spacewalks are extremely strenuous and contain months of coaching.

Final yr, NASA canceled a deliberate spacewalk after an astronaut reportedly skilled “spacesuit discomfort.” In 2021, U.S. astronaut Mark Vande Hei’s spacewalk was known as off because of a pinched nerve.
